Bitcoin miner Riot Platforms has announced a significant partnership with artificial intelligence company Anthropic, securing a $9 billion, 20-year compute deal. This strategic move highlights a notable shift in the focus of bitcoin mining companies towards AI infrastructure, as they adapt to changing market conditions and seek new revenue opportunities.

Riot Platforms, known for its large-scale bitcoin mining operations, is pivoting towards the burgeoning field of artificial intelligence. The agreement with Anthropic allows Riot to provide extensive computational resources necessary for AI development. This partnership marks a potential turning point for the bitcoin mining industry, traditionally focused on cryptocurrency, as miners explore alternative avenues for growth.

The $9 billion deal is structured to deliver significant computational power over the next two decades, helping Anthropic advance its AI technologies. Riot Platforms will leverage its existing infrastructure and expertise in running large-scale data centers to meet the demands of the expanding AI sector. As the cryptocurrency market faces increasing regulatory scrutiny and volatile price movements, many bitcoin miners are reassessing their business models. A growing number of companies are recognizing the profitability and sustainability of diversifying into AI and other tech sectors. The partnership with Anthropic is a clear example of this trend, as Riot Platforms seeks to capitalize on the surging demand for AI capabilities.

Riot Platforms' CEO, Jason Les, emphasized the strategic nature of the deal, stating that it aligns with the company's long-term vision of becoming a leader in high-performance computing. The collaboration with Anthropic not only provides a new revenue stream but also positions Riot at the forefront of the technological evolution occurring across industries.
